图片处理——OpenCV——图片旋转(一)

1 import cv2
2 
3 img_path = r"E:	mp	mp.jpg"
4 image = cv2.imread(img_path)
5 cv2.imshow("image", image)
6 cv2.waitKey(5000)

镜像/顺时针旋转180度

1 image1 = cv2.flip(image, -1)
2 cv2.imshow("image", image1)
3 cv2.waitKey(5000)

转置

1 image2 = cv2.transpose(image)
2 cv2.imshow("0", image2)
3 cv2.waitKey(5000)

顺时针旋转90度

image3 = cv2.transpose(image)
image3 = cv2.flip(image3, 1)
cv2.imshow("1", image3)
cv2.waitKey(5000)

顺时针旋转270度

1 image4 = cv2.transpose(image)
2 image4 = cv2.flip(image4, 0)
3 cv2.imshow("1", image4)
4 cv2.waitKey(5000)

原文地址:https://www.cnblogs.com/timelesszxl/p/14577012.html